Football player accused of rape adds to his defense team

LOGAN, Utah (AP) — A former Utah State football player accused of sexually assaulting seven women has added two high-profile consultants to his defense team.

The Herald Journal reports investigators F. Lee Bailey and Pat McKenna will help defend 25-year-old ex-linebaker Torrey Green.

Bailey was on the OJ Simpson “dream team” when he was acquitted on murder charges in 1994, though he was later disbarred in two states. McKenna is a private detective who worked on the Simpson case as well as that of Casey Anthony, a Florida mother acquitted in her daughter’s death in 2011.

A spokesman for Green says the pair is working pro bono.

Green is set for trial Jan. 4 on rape, kidnapping and other charges from 2013 through 2015. He has said he is innocent.
